The investigation focused on a total of 13 people — in Ohio, Wisconsin, Arizona, California, Colorado, Georgia, Illinois, Mississippi, Missouri, Washington and Wisconsin — who were diagnosed with a particular strain of salmonella infection, with illnesses occurring between December 2010 and March 2011, USDA’s food-safety officials said. The federal agency and the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ention determined that three of the patients ispecifically reported eating the Jennie-O Turkey Burgers; the last of these illnesses was reported on March 14.
A spokeswoman for the Ohio Department of Health said the Ohioan mentioned in the USDA news release as among those sickened is a 78-year-old man from Mahoning County.
